After decades of tension between the northern and southern states over slavery, state rights, and westward expansion, civil war broke out in the United States on April 12, 1861. 

The Civil War also known as the war between the United States ended on April 9, 1865, with the Confederate surrender. The United States Civil War was fought between the United States of America and the Confederate United States, a collection of eleven southern states that left the Union in 1860 and 1861. 

The conflict originally began as a result of a long-running disagreement with the organization over slavery.



The first and primary reason was economic interest. 

The southern states wanted to impose their authority on the federal government so that they could repeal federal laws that they did not support, especially since the law was interfering with the southern slave rights and would take them wherever it wished. 

There were many political and cultural differences between the North and the South that contributed to the American Civil War, the cause of the war was slavery. A general explanation was the civil war over the moral issue of slavery. 

It was the slavery of that system and the economy of political control that was at the center of the conflict. A key issue was state rights. So, Economic interest is the primary issue for this war.



The second reason was cultural values like Different social cultures and political beliefs develop. All of this led to disagreements over issues such as taxes, duties, and internal development, as well as state rights against federal rights. Two important, famous, documented battles resulted in the defeat of the Confederates: the Battle of Gettysburg, July 3-8, and the Falls of Vicksburg, July 4. 

The culture of civil war in America - both north and south - was different from life in the Antebellum years. When the war began to drag on, the soldier's life ranged from inferior clothing and equipment to just edible and usually inadequate rations to regular patience and deprivation.



The third reason was the power of the federal government to control the state's so-called slavery in American society. Agriculture South used slaves to carry out its large plantations and other duties. 

About 4 million Africans and their descendants worked as slave laborers in the South before the Civil War. Slavery was inherent in the southern economy even though a relatively small portion of the population owned slaves. 

Ownership of a handful of slaves respects ownership and contributes to social status, and slaves, as the property of individuals and businesses, represent the largest share of personal and corporate wealth in the region. 



The war effectively ended on April 9, 1865, when Confederate General Lee surrendered to Union General Grant at the Court of Apothecary after leaving Petersburg. At the end of the war, most of the infrastructure in the south was destroyed, especially its railways. 

The war-torn nation then entered an era of reconstruction with partially successful attempts to restructure the country and grant civil rights to free slaves.
